At least one tornado was spotted and Crypen Exchangeconfirmed in Kansas on Wednesday as severe storms moved through the state in the evening and overnight.
The tornado was spotted near the small town of Alta Vista in northeast Kansas, according to meteorologist Jack Maney with KSN News.
Alta Vista is about 65 miles southwest of Kansas' capital Topeka, and both cities are located west of Kansas City.
The National Weather Service office in Topeka had issued multiple tornado warnings and severe thunderstorm warnings throughout the area on Wednesday, including in Alta Vista. In addition to tornadoes, the weather service warned of high winds and the possibility of golf ball-sized hail.
Severe thunderstorm warnings were also issued in nearby states to Kansas on Wednesday, including in Missouri, Iowa and Illinois.
